Carnivore Bacon Chocolate Cake
A decadent, chocolatey cake with a savory twist—crispy bacon bits combined with creamy chocolate for the ultimate carnivore-friendly dessert.
Ingredients (8-inch cake, serves 6–8)
-
1 cup cream cheese, softened
-
½ cup unsalted butter, softened
-
4 large eggs
-
½ cup unsweetened cocoa powder
-
½ cup shredded cheddar or mozzarella cheese (optional for extra texture)
-
¼ cup heavy cream
-
6 slices crispy bacon, chopped
-
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
-
¼ teaspoon salt
Instructions
-
Preheat oven:
Set o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ease an 8-inch cake pan with butter or line with parchment paper. -
Prepare bacon:
Cook bacon until crispy, then chop into small pieces. Set aside. -
Mix butter and cream cheese:
In a large bowl, beat the cream cheese and butter together until smooth and creamy. -
Add eggs and vanilla:
Beat in the eggs one at a time, then add vanilla extract. Mix well. -
Incorporate dry ingredients:
Sift in cocoa powder and salt, then fold gently until fully combined. -
Add cheese and bacon:
Fold in shredded cheese (if using) and chopped bacon evenly throughout the batter. -
Bake the cake:
Pour batter into the prepared pan. Bake for 25–30 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out mostly clean (a few crumbs are okay). -
Cool and serve:
Let the cake cool for 10–15 minutes before slicing. Serve warm or at room temperature.
Optional Topping
-
Sprinkle extra crispy bacon on top or drizzle with melted cream cheese for a “frosted” effect.
Tips
-
Use high-quality cocoa powder for the best chocolate flavor.
-
For extra indulgence, fold in small chocolate chunks (sugar-free or unsweetened).
-
Store leftovers in the fridge for up to 3 days.
